New It's not that bad, however...
...I ate a lot less of it once I knew what was in it :)

My Dad used to cook it up occasionally on a Sunday when I was a kiddie - he'd cook it in a frypan with slices of apple, and top it off with a light sprinkling of raw sugar.

I don't know if this is the done thing for black pudding, or just my Dad's idea. Either way, it worked - quite tasty, says my 20-odd-years-ago memory of it.
